This is the complete third season of "Saturday Night Live" and if you are any kind of fan of this show you have to buy these box sets. This is the second one Universal has sent me to take a peek at and they are phenomenal! Universal has taken great care in the presentation by offering up the complete 90-minute installments and the packaging includes the special guest and musical guest for each episode and the day it aired. You get people like Steve Martin, Hugh Hefner, Ray Charles, Chevy Chase, Christopher Lee, Michael Palin, Richard Dreyfuss and even O.J. Simpson. On top of that you get The Nerds, The Coneheads, Samurai Warrior by John Belushi, Singing King Tut by Steve Martin and a ton more. I know there are die-hard fans of this show out there and I would hate for you to somehow miss these.
